The Oxford First Illustrated Science Dictionary supports the curriculum and gives your child a head start in understanding first scientific words. Organised alphabetically, this dictionary gives simple and clear meanings for over 300 scientific words and concepts, from 'abdomen' to 'zoo'.

Each entry is illustrated with child-friendly artwork plus diagrams to explain, add meaning, and support the definition.

Expertly-levelled supplementary material in anillustrated section at the back lists the everyday vocabulary children will come across in their science lessons including the equipment used in class.
